Poland - Positron Emission Tomography Exams

Since 2014, Poland Positron Emission Tomography Exams was up 8.6%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 13 comparing other countries in Positron Emission Tomography Exams at 61,959 Exams. Poland is overtaken by Israel, which was number 12 at 77,498 Exams and is followed by Denmark with 60,637 Exams. United States lead the ranking with 2,115,853 Exams in 2019, that is +1.4% compared to 2018. France, Italy and Turkey resp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Austria recorded the best 5 years average growth at +32.2% per year, while South Korea witnessed the worst performance at -13.3% per year.
